Bespoke Hydraulic Actuator Customization: From Concept to Production
The journey of a unique hydraulic actuator from initial concept to full-scale manufacturing is a meticulously planned sequence. It begins with a thorough assessment of the client's particular application needs – considering factors like working pressure, stroke length, and environmental conditions. Typically, this involves close collaboration between the engineer and the client, potentially utilizing Computer-Aided models and simulations to confirm the architecture. Once the architecture is finalized, element selection, which frequently includes specialized alloy grades, commences. Later, the fabrication procedure incorporates precise machining operations, bonding techniques, and stringent control measures to guarantee optimal functionality and durability. Building Custom Hydraulic Cylinders: Materials & Functionality
The creation of custom hydraulic cylinders demands thorough consideration of material selection and their direct impact on overall operational capability. Often, cylinder bodies are manufactured from alloy, with choices ranging from mild grades to robust rust-resistant types, depending on the intended purpose and surrounding conditions. Rod substances are equally necessary; hardened steel is commonly employed for posts to withstand erosion and corrosion. Gasket materials, such as NBR or polyurethane, are picked based on heat bounds, liquid suitability, and force ratings. In conclusion, a complete way to component planning ensures the fluid cylinder delivers the required power and lifespan for its specific role.
